Abstract

A method and apparatus for discriminating discs include a loading mechanism transporting discs at an entrance of a disk driver. A sensor unit close to the loading mechanism starts or stops the loading mechanism according to the detection. Two ends of a receptor dispose two symmetric positioning posts for positioning automatically. The center of the receptor disposes a limited pin to limit the moving distance of the receptor based on the disc size discriminated by the sensor unit. The disc size can be discriminated by counting sensors on for judging increase or decrease, and counting loading time for comparing with the predetermined time.

As shown in FIG. 1 , a conventional slot-type disc player 10 is taken as an example. The slot-in disc drive 10 has a conical strip-shaped roller 12 at the inlet 1 1 and a front-to-roll coating 1 2 The sensors 1 3 a and 1 3 b, by the sensor 1 3 a, the sensing disc 1 4 is inserted, immediately rotates the roller 1 2 and sucks the inserted disc 1 4 into the disc player 10, and utilizes The stator rods 1 5 symmetrical centering rods 1 5 a and 1 5 b receive the circumference of one end of the disc 1 4 so that the center of the disc 14 is automatically aligned with the center line of the spindle motor 16 and then driven by the roller 12 The lower 'tab lever 15 is slid with the centering locking stems 5 5 a and 15 b along the parallel chutes 1 7a and 17b, and the center of the transporting disc 14 reaches the spindle motor 16 to rotate the spindle motor 16 Disc 14 to complete the positioning. In addition, when the film is unloaded, the roll 1 2 is reversely rotated, so that the disk 1 4 is ejected from the disk drive 1 0. When the disk 1 4 is disengaged from the sensor 1 3 b, the rotation of the roller 12 is stopped, so that the disk 1 is rotated. 4 at the entrance 1 1, waiting to be taken. Due to the different sizes of the discs 14, the position of the center of the discs 14 will change, and the moving distance of the tabs 15 will need to be changed, otherwise the undisposed discs 14 will be crushed. Therefore, the conventional disc player 10 is provided with a selector lever 1 8 on the side and a selectively interlocking actuator arm 9 9 on the rear side as a mechanism for discriminating the disc. When the 8cm disc 14a is fed, it will not touch the selector lever due to its small size.

INSTRUCTIONS (2) .1 8. The starting arm 19 will remain in its original position. The ejector lever 15 is slid in the transporting disc 14 by the ejector pin 15 and the spur pin 15c is slid in the slot 19a of the actuating arm 19, and is moved along the > chute 1 7c to drive the actuating arm 19 to be embedded. The support shaft 1 9 b placed in the moving groove 1 0 1 is rotated centrally, so that the limit pin 1 9 c on the actuating arm 19 moves along the small groove side 1 0 2 a of the cam groove 1 0 2 while limiting The slider 1 5 moves a small distance to move the 8 cm disc 1 4 a to position. As shown in FIG. 2, when the 12 cm disc 14b is fed, the front end portion 18a of the selector lever 18 is dialed by the larger diameter p, and the selector lever 18 is rotated about the pivot point 18b. The rear end portion 18c of the 18 is pushed by the starting arm 19, and the support shaft 1 9b is moved inward along the moving groove 110, while the limit pin 1 9c is inserted into the large groove of the cam groove 1 0 2 in. Then, the ejector lever 15 is slid in the transporting disc 14b with the protruding pin 15c in the slot 19a of the starting arm 19, and moves along the chute 1 7c to drive the starting arm 19 . Rotating around the fulcrum 1 9 b causes the limit pin 1 9 c to move along the large groove side 1 0 2 b of the cam groove 1 0 2, so that the splicing rod 15 can be moved a long distance, and 1 2 cm • Disc 1 4 b moves to position. However, the conventional disc player 10 uses a multi-bar mechanism to discriminate the size of the disc, and although the discs of 8 cm and 12 cm can be moved forward and backward, the selector lever 1 8 of the inlet 11 is placed at the front end. 1 8a is easily touched by the 8cm disc® that is offset from the insertion, causing malfunction and damage to the disc. At the same time, the multi-bar mechanism requires a sufficient stacking height, which not only causes the thickness of the disc to be thinned, but also has many parts of the multi-bar, high management and cost, and is complicated and time-consuming to manufacture and assemble. 如圖4所示,本發明之碟片判別方法,首先為開始步 驟S 1,將碟片2 7***碟機2 0,感測單元2 1進行偵測步驟 S 2,當任一感測器2 2 1、2 2 2、2 2 3及2 2 4開始動作,立即啟 動滾輪2 2,以轉動滾輪2 2的步驟S 3吸入碟片2 7,同時,以 計數步驟S4記錄感測單元2 1中感測器動作的數目,且以計 時步驟S5開始計時,記錄進片的時間,然後由判斷感測器 動作數目減少的步驟S6,藉由不同尺寸碟片具有不同直 徑,於直徑通過時所能遮住感測器的數目,決定碟片尺 寸,雖使用較密集的感測器可增加判別的碟片尺寸種類, 但相對會增加零件成本,本實施例以四個感測器判別8cmAs shown in FIG. 4, the disc discriminating method of the present invention firstly inserts the disc 2 7 into the disc player 20 from the start step S1, and the sensing unit 2 1 performs the detecting step S2, when any sensor 2 2 1, 2 2 2, 2 2 3 and 2 2 4 start the action, immediately start the roller 2 2, and take the step S 3 of the roller 2 2 to suck the disc 2 7, while recording the sensing unit 2 in the counting step S4 The number of sensor actions in 1 is started in timing step S5, the time of filming is recorded, and then step S6 is performed to determine the number of actions of the sensor is reduced, and the disks of different sizes have different diameters when the diameter passes. The number of sensors can be blocked, and the size of the disc can be determined. Although a denser sensor can be used to increase the disc size, but the relative cost is increased. In this embodiment, 8 cm is determined by four sensors.

第10頁 1276051 五、發明說明(6) 及1 2 c m碟片為例,8 c m碟片可遮住三個感測器,而1 2 c _ 片可遮住四個感測器,因此在開始之後,感測器動作的數 目會持續增加,一旦偵測出感測器動作的數目減少,就以 步驟S 7判定為次種碟片,即8 c m碟片。否則,就進入步驟 S8比較進片的時間是否超過預定的時間,由於碟片可遮住 所有感測器的弦長所在的距離,在滾輪2 1的轉速一定下, 可計算出碟片前進的所需的時間,本發明為例約為0. 3 秒,超出所需的預定時間未遮住所有感測器,即可以步驟 S 7判定為次種碟片,如計時經比較仍未超過預定時間,則 至下一步驟S 9判斷是否所有感測器動作,即遮住所有感測 器,如已遮住所有感測器則可以步驟S 1 0判定為主要碟 片,1 2 c m碟片,否則重覆步驟S 3轉動滾輪2 2繼續吸入碟 片27。 因此,本發明之碟片判別方法,以進片時間及感測器 動作數目的變化等兩道判別碟片尺寸的程序,交叉判斷方 式,可快速判別出碟片尺寸,又可避免碟片誤觸判別機 構,讓碟機快速、正確反應所承接碟片的尺寸,提高可靠 性。 此外,如圖5所示,本發明之碟片判別方法亦可用於 篩選適用碟片尺寸之碟機,其中開始步驟R 1、偵測步驟 R 2、轉動滾輪的步驟R 3、計數步驟R 4、計時步驟R 5、判斷 感測器動作數目減少的步驟R6及步驟R8比較進片的時間是 否超過預定的時間,與前述碟片判別方法之步驟S 1至S 8所 用的過程及方法相同,不同處在於當步驟R6判斷感測器動Page 10 1276051 5. Inventive Note (6) and 1 2 cm discs, for example, 8 cm discs can cover three sensors, while 1 2 c _ sheets can cover four sensors, so After the start, the number of sensor actions will continue to increase. Once the number of sensor actions is detected to decrease, it is determined in step S7 as the next disc, that is, the 8 cm disc. Otherwise, the process proceeds to step S8 to compare whether the time of feeding into the film exceeds a predetermined time. Since the disc can cover the distance of the chord length of all the sensors, the rotation of the roller 21 can be determined, and the advancement of the disc can be calculated. The time required for the present invention is about 0.3 seconds, and all the sensors are not blocked beyond the required predetermined time, that is, the next type of disc can be determined in step S7, if the timing is still not exceeded. Time, then to the next step S9 to determine whether all the sensors operate, that is, to cover all the sensors, if all the sensors have been blocked, then it can be determined as the main disc in step S1 0, the 1 2 cm disc Otherwise, the step S3 is repeated to rotate the roller 2 2 to continue to suck the disc 27. Therefore, in the disc discriminating method of the present invention, two discriminating disc size programs, such as a change in the feeding time and the number of sensor movements, and the cross judging method can quickly discriminate the disc size and avoid disc discrepancy. Touching the discriminating mechanism allows the disc player to quickly and correctly reflect the size of the discs it receives and improve reliability.
